Have You Disqualified Yourself?
“I am convinced that nothing can ever separate us from his love.” Romans 8:38 NLT
Have you resigned yourself to a dark, never-ending valley? A valley can be many things, but perhaps for you, it’s a prison you have willingly entered. You’ve pronounced judgment on your sins, pulled the bars closed on your life, and tossed the key.
What have you done? What evil deed resigned you to this fate? What do you feel has disqualified you so entirely that you have entered this state of suspension—suspending life, suspending love?
There is nothing that can separate you from the love of God. There is no sin so dark that the blood of Jesus cannot cover.
Consider Paul. As a young man, he watched over the clothes of Stephen’s accusers as they stoned him to death. He then became a deadly persecutor of the early church (Acts 7:58). It mirrored the horrific tales you hear in today’s news when a church is attacked, its pastor and members beaten or killed or imprisoned.
Or consider Peter, an apostle, one of the 12 who was side by side with Jesus for three and a half years. Yet when Peter was confronted concerning his alliance with the Lord, he denied it. With Jesus but a few yards away and Peter in his line of sight, three times Peter denied even knowing the man (Luke 23:60–62).
Both of these men could easily be disqualified. Sinners beyond saving. And yet...
God apprehended Paul and gave him a mission to preach salvation to the Gentiles. And Peter quickly found his way to repentance and forgiveness, becoming a bold leader of the early church. He was eventually martyred for his faith.
There is no sin that Jesus’ blood cannot cover. A call and a purpose is waiting out there for you, beyond the walls of your self-constructed prison. Receive your forgiveness and pick up the mantle of God’s plan for your life. Walk out of your valley and live.
Pray:“God, I confess my sin and I seek your forgiveness. I believe you have a plan for my life and I embrace it now, through the blood and the name of Jesus Christ, amen.”
Seek: Are you prolonging your valley? What do you feel has disqualified you from serving the Lord? Today, seek God’s forgiveness and mercy. Walk in the plan he has for your life.
Speak: The blood of Jesus covers my sin. Nothing can separate me from God’s love.
